Not by a long shot! Example: Brooks Defyance I, which I intend on buying as many as I can afford before they're gone are $81.00 at telarun. Runningwarehouse has them at $59.95 and Holabirdsports at $64.95. These are the cheapest and best shipping (FREE) that I have found, and I have looked at almost all the others mentioned in the past. Of course I have not researched all makes and models, so there might be one or two that one may be cheaper than elsewhere. Another site, Paragonsports.com has exceptional prices on select models only. They had the cheapest Asic's Speedstar 2's a year back, but I haven't found them having what I want or pricewhise lately.
